5. Golghar
Located in the vibrant country of India, Golghar is a historical site that holds significant cultural importance. This iconic landmark in the city of Patna stands tall as a symbol of the region's rich history and architectural marvel. Built by Captain John Garstin in 1786, Golghar was originally designed to store grains during times of famine. Today, it stands as a testament to the past, attracting tourists from around the world to witness its grandeur.

9. Kesaria Stupa East Champaran
Kesaria Stupa in East Champaran is a significant historical and cultural site in Bihar, India. The stupa is believed to date back to the 3rd century BC and is one of the largest Buddhist stupas in the world. It holds immense historical importance as it is said to enshrine the relics of Lord Buddha. The architecture and design of the stupa showcase the rich heritage of Buddhism in the region. Kesaria Stupa is famous for its grandeur and spiritual significance, attracting tourists and pilgrims from around the globe.

10. Khuda Bakhsh Oriental Library
Khuda Bakhsh Oriental Library is a renowned destination in Patna, India, known for its rich historical significance and cultural heritage. Established in 1900, the library houses a vast collection of rare Arabic, Persian, and Urdu manuscripts, making it a treasure trove for scholars and history enthusiasts. The architecture of the building itself reflects the grandeur of a bygone era, attracting visitors from around the world.

13. Mahatma Gandhi Setu
Mahatma Gandhi Setu, located in Bihar, India, is a significant landmark known for its historical importance. The bridge spans the River Ganges and connects the cities of Patna and Hajipur. This engineering marvel is named after the iconic leader of India's independence movement, Mahatma Gandhi. The bridge plays a vital role in the transportation network of the region, making it a crucial link for commuters and travelers.

17. Patna Museum
Patna Museum, located in the capital city of Bihar, India, is a treasure trove of historical artifacts and cultural heritage. Established in 1917, the museum boasts a rich collection of sculptures, paintings, and artifacts dating back to ancient and medieval periods. Patna, known for its significant role in the history of India, is a melting pot of cultures and traditions, making it a must-visit destination for history buffs and art enthusiasts alike.

21. Sonepur Mela Vaishali
Sonepur Mela in Vaishali is one of the most famous and oldest fairs in India. Located in the state of Bihar, the fair has a rich historical significance dating back to ancient times. It is known for being the biggest cattle fair in Asia, attracting traders and visitors from all over the world. The fair combines spirituality, culture, and commerce, making it a unique and vibrant experience for travelers.
